Last year, the Missouri Legislature lost six weeks of work due to the onset of COVID-19. This year’s legislative session has already seen both the house and the senate forced to take breaks due to outbreaks of the virus, and the weather. Representative Cheri Toalson Reisch says despite these temporary shut downs they are moving quickly on a variety of legislation.

The Hallsville Republican adds that the potential for a similar shutdown to last year is also making them work quicker.

The 2021 Missouri Legislative Session is scheduled to run through May 14th.
